The only times I have actually seen the errors you mentioned have been when I have inadvertently hit the EQMOD imposed mount limits when getting things set up to do automated flips in either APT or SGP, mostly in SGP as it behaves differently. SGP was waiting until 5 minutes after the meridian to flip and the default limit in EQMOD did not let it go that far and would stop the tracking. Among the other errors was the PDH2 "Unable to move far enough"
Or is this happening during your PHD2 calibration process? If so the calibration steps might be too small.
